What companies run services between Miami Dade College, FL, USA and Fort Lauderdale, FL, USA?

Brightline operates a train from Miami to Fort Lauderdale hourly. Tickets cost $18–45 and the journey takes 33 min. Alternatively, Jet Set Express operates a bus from Bayside Marketplace to Fort Lauderdale - Broward Blvd Park and Ride once daily. Tickets cost $27–35 and the journey takes 1h 15m.
